Transaction 5f93ae07d7795e75fdc1a6025f7ef76e24e96dae58d56d803b3f16176ef6622f

1 Input
1 Outputs
  • 5f93ae07d7795e75fdc1a6025f7ef76e24e96dae58d56d803b3f16176ef6622f:0
  • value  128173265
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G